Sponsor's own description
The aeronautical community was also affected and greatly impacted economically and socially by the Covid-19 pandemic. Away from the acute phase, the epidemiological impact and the consequences of this disease within the French aviation flight crew population must be assessed. This study is aimed at providing original epidemiological data among civil and military aircrew, prior to possible prevention strategies or countermeasures to optimize risk management in terms of aviation safety and to promote, if necessary, future targeted studies.
